Frequency Theory
A theory in hearing that suggests the frequency of the auditory nerve's impulses corresponds to the frequency of a sound wave, affecting the pitch we perceive.
Visual Perception
The capability to understand the immediate surroundings through the analysis of information found in visible light.
Sensory Impressions
Perceptions or feelings resulting from the stimulation of the senses, including sight, sound, smell, touch, and taste.
Middle Ear
The portion of the ear internal to the eardrum, and external to the oval window of the cochlea, containing the three auditory ossicles.
